In the Chuvash Republic, criminal proceedings have been initiated against the former chief of a penal settlement who exploited prisoners in the construction of his own house.




As Construction.ru was told by the press office of the regional department of the Investigative Committee of Russia, the former chief of the penal colony is accused of abuse of office.

A 43-year man headed the colony settlement №8 in the Alatyr district. From May to November 2014 he exploited two prisoners as general workers in the construction of his house in the town of Alatyr. The perpetrator acted from mercenary motives and vested interests.

At present, the investigation is continuing.

Alatyr is one of the oldest towns in the Chuvash Republic — it was founded in 1552. The town’s population currently stands at 38,203 people.
